Biography

Amy E. Orlando is an attorney who practices in the areas of Elder Law, Estate Planning, Estate Administration and Taxation. Prior to entering private practice, Amy completed a two-year clerkship in the York County Court of Common Pleas, for the Honorable John C. Uhler, after which she spent three years in private practice in the areas of Estate Planning, Estate Administration, Business/Corporate law, and Taxation.

She graduated Cum Laude with Honors from Wake Forest University, in Winston-Salem, North Carolina, while also playing Division I Field Hockey, as a goalkeeper, in the Atlantic Coast Conference. Prior to attending law school, she worked in Social Services in Virginia and Massachusetts, and in 2003, received her Juris Doctorate from Suffolk University Law School, in Boston, Massachusetts, Cum Laude.

Amy is licensed to practice law in the State of Connecticut and the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, and is a past and current member of their respective Bar Associations. She is an accredited Attorney with the Veterans Administration and is a member of the National Academy of Elder Law Attorneys and the Central Connecticut Business and Planning Council.
